Overview
The purpose of this document is to specify Ofqual's requirements to suppliers interested in tendering for the contract to undertake research into Applied General qualifications in early 2017. The surveying will identify the views and uses of stakeholders in relation to qualifications included by the Department for Education as 'Applied General qualifications' for the purpose of Key Stage Five Performance Tables. There are three different strands of research that will be covered in this work; 1. Research with HEIs, teachers and learners using a combination of focus groups and individual interviews 2.
